Вопрос:

Как сделать поиск по двум коллекциям в mongodb?

Обсуждаем вопрос Как сделать поиск по двум коллекциям в mongodb? что вы знаете?

Нам интересно ваше мнение о вопросе Как сделать поиск по двум коллекциям в mongodb?.

Поделитесь вашей версией ответа к вопросу Как сделать поиск по двум коллекциям в mongodb?.

Комментируем вопрос: Как сделать поиск по двум коллекциям в mongodb? что известно?

0

Опубликовано

в

спросил

Ответы, комментарии, мнения на вопрос.

Да вопрос очень интересный давайте обсудим и вместе найдем ответ кто что знает или думает?

Знаете ответ на этот вопрос? Опубликуйте его ваше мнение будет интересно другим пользователям!

Один комментарий на ««Как сделать поиск по двум коллекциям в mongodb?»»

  1. Аватар пользователя Loomotmka
    Loomotmka

    Для того чтобы сделать поиск по двум коллекциям в MongoDB, можно использовать оператор $lookup, который позволяет объединить данные из двух коллекций по определенному условию.

    Пример запроса с использованием $lookup:

    “`
    db.collection1.aggregate([
    {
    $lookup:
    {
    from: “collection2”,
    localField: “field1”,
    foreignField: “field2”,
    as: “result”
    }
    }
    ])
    “`

    Где:
    – `collection1` и `collection2` – названия коллекций, по которым проводится поиск
    – `field1` и `field2` – поля, по которым происходит объединение данных
    – `result` – название поля, в котором будут содержаться результаты поиска

    Таким образом, используя оператор $lookup, можно объединить данные из двух коллекций и провести поиск по ним одновременно.

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*

Вопросов : 110,338 Ответов : 128,536

  1. Попробуйте изменить ключевые слова поиска или обратиться к другим источникам информации, таким как библиотеки, специализированные сайты или эксперты в данной…

  2. Если вода вытекает из кофемашины, возможно, есть несколько причин: 1. Неправильно закрыт резервуар с водой или он поврежден. 2. Проблемы…